Background

Dawn advises and defends employers in workers’ compensation and employment matters. In this capacity, she represents her clients in mediations, in litigation at the North Carolina Industrial Commission and in appeals before the North Carolina Supreme Court. She is experienced in defending hospitals in workers’ compensation and employment matters and in defending occupational exposure claims, including asbestosis and silicosis claims. Her clients include Rex HealthCare, Cracker Barrel, General Electric, North Carolina Farm Bureau Mutual Insurance Company, Gallagher Bassett and Allied Claims Administration

Dawn joined Young Moore and Henderson in 1996 after completing a judicial clerkship at the North Carolina Court of Appeals with Judges Jack Cozart and Donnie Smith. She is a senior member of the firm’s workers’ compensation team. She is an active member of several firm management committees and represents the firm in several ALFA International practice groups including workers’ compensation, employment law and women in the profession. Dawn regularly speaks at seminars for clients and other lawyers on workers’ compensation and employment law topics.
